Rents, mortgages and crowding.
Typical weekly rent is $340, which is higher than most similar areas and about the same as the Northern Territory figure. Monthly mortgage payments usually sit at $1,733, a little below the territory average.

How homes are owned or rented.
Renting is very common here at 47.1%, which is far above the national figure of 30.6%. While 20.9% of homes are owned outright, this is far below the Australian average.

Houses, townhouses, apartments and bedrooms.
Separate houses are far less common here than across Australia, making up only 52.5% of homes. Many residents live in flats or apartments, and with fewer large homes, the number of people per bedroom is a little above the national figure.
